WebAs a paralegal, you'll carry out certain legal tasks and services, such as undertaking legal research, preparing and negotiating legal documents and giving some legal advice. Although you will have received some form of training, you are not a qualified solicitor, barrister, chartered legal executive or licenced conveyancer. Litigation Paralegal: Duties, Responsibilities, and More

WebA paralegal is a legal professional who works in an assistive capacity. They will be employed in a law firm and will support the firm’s attorneys in whatever way they need. Paralegals are very similar to physician’s assistants in that they share many of the same responsibilities as a full lawyer, but have some limitations for what they are allowed to do. Web23 Mar 2024 · A litigation paralegal assists a lawyer before, during and after court proceedings. A paralegal can't provide legal advice, but they can assist lawyers by researching legal documents, organising documents and drafting legal correspondence.

Web2 Oct 2024 · A litigation paralegal is a specialist who is responsible for assisting attorneys throughout the trial process. On the plaintiff side, litigation paralegals conduct initial client interviews and legal research for case preparations. They assist with the preliminary examinations of witnesses and jury selection in the courtroom.
